【问题标题】:Cloud9 IDE - Getting Workspace URL and user email in terminalCloud9 IDE - 在终端中获取工作区 URL 和用户电子邮件
【发布时间】:2017-01-08 15:06:20
【问题描述】:

我正在编写一个 bash 脚本,我需要从终端当前工作区 URL 和 cloud9 用户电子邮件中获取。

我试过了:

  • 从主机名变量中提取数据,但它不是工作区域。
  • 从 .c9 项目文件夹中提取它,但域和用户电子邮件似乎没有出现在那里

任何想法如何从 c9 终端中获取这些详细信息?

【问题讨论】:

  • 从主机名中提取它有什么问题?主机名应该是 username-workspacename-workspaceid。只需废弃 id,然后使用 workspacename-username.c9users.io 作为预览 URL。对于工作区 URL,您需要 ide.c9.io/username/workspacename

标签: cloud9-ide cloud9


【解决方案1】:

在托管工作空间上,您可以使用$C9_* 环境变量,试试

echo $C9_EMAIL $C9_FULLNAME $C9_HOSTNAME $C9_PROJECT 

【讨论】:

    猜你喜欢
    • 2011-10-24
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2018-04-24
    • 1970-01-01
    • 2017-04-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多